The intelligence of everyone involved keeps it from being Jeff Foxworthy-worthy, with the interludes and adlibs as rewindable as Doom's lyrics. But for what it attempts- which is basically a comedy record with no-joke skills- it exceeds expectations. It's not as revealing as Doom's other work, and Danger Mouse's big, Technicolor productions here are a little too trivial to be immortal. Elsewhere, Cee-Lo stops by to croon over the fuzz and slap of "Bizzy Box" Talib Kweli lightens up and raps simply about breakfast cereal and Ghostface recollects his own days behind the disguise on "The Mask", which certainly builds anticipation for a rumored GhostDoom project.ĭanger Doom won't change your life. The labyrinthine self-analyses of Madvillainy are mostly absent, but Doom remains sharp, focused on slaying a cavalcade of smartass cartoons.

Lex has a history of lavish packaging but this remains one of the lushest sleeves in the catalogue. Designed by EHQuestionmark, the outer sleeve is made from thick translucent textured plastic with DOOM's mask printed on the cover, and mouse ears on each side of the mask forming a pattern that looks like a Rorschach test (a technique reused in another Danger Mouse project six months later). Originally only available in Europe in limited quantities, Lex have repressed the Deluxe double vinyl LP edition of ‘The Mouse & The Mask’ for 2019.
